Question
Can you tell me the procedure for replacing the headgasket on my 1996 Honda 90AT. I'm a mechanic, but on golf course turf equipment and have all the tools, just need a little knowledge. Also a parts list if you have it.

Answer
Bill doing a head gasket on a Honda is a serious job. In most cases the cam belt and gear need removing. It is far beyond the scope of this site to give instructions. You may need some special tools as well.
I would highly recommend getting a service manual and following the procedure word for word. It can be a daunting challenge. Sorry I can't help much more, a head job takes up a full chapter in the service manual.
